Output ea2c81bc2e94b790894264ba43d2ef290324e5dfa5ab582c623a1a6649a5df21:0

value
174289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8337b7b817e03b5edf71cb7e86ddfc53eba56fb8 OP_EQUAL
address
3DeqC1BTCsB9YU76n28oc6UaPtUc6TsjEN
transaction
ea2c81bc2e94b790894264ba43d2ef290324e5dfa5ab582c623a1a6649a5df21